The compact presentation for the alternating central extension of the $q$-Onsager algebra

Abstract

The qq-Onsager algebra OqO_q is defined by two generators and two relations, called the qq-Dolan/Grady relations. We investigate the alternating central extension Oq\mathcal O_q of OqO_q. The algebra Oq\mathcal O_q was introduced by Baseilhac and Koizumi, who called it the current algebra of OqO_q. Recently Baseilhac and Shigechi gave a presentation of Oq\mathcal O_q by generators and relations. The presentation is attractive, but the multitude of generators and relations makes the presentation unwieldy. In this paper we obtain a presentation of Oq\mathcal O_q that involves a subset of the original set of generators and a very manageable set of relations. We call this presentation the compact presentation of Oq\mathcal O_q. This presentation resembles the compact presentation of the alternating central extension for the positive part of Uq(sl^2)U_q(\widehat{\mathfrak{sl}}_2).
